BOWLING TOURNAMENT (Own Correspondent). PATEA, Feb. 7. The Patea rink, Williams, Beil, Hurley and Sheilds, were the winners of the one-day tournament held by the Hawera Bowling Club last Saturday, out of 28 rinks from various parts of Taranaki. Patea and Fitzroy tied in section B, with 5i wins, and in the play-off Patea won 8 to 1. In the final Patea played Stratford, winners of the A division, defeating them 10-9.
